
STM32G474CBT6 串口通信问题
stm32的同一个定时器,不同的通道,可以不同时的输出pwm波形吗
USB Device + FatFS + 外挂 flash
STM32F103C8T6 TIM1 CH2输入捕获触发DMA的问题
STM32F103在使用HAL库1.8.5版本使用串口中断发送数据的时候,会出现huart2->TxXferCount为0了,但是并没有清除掉TXEIE中断也没有使能TCIE中断,而且huart2->gState已经被置为HAL_UART_STATE_READE,导致了一直在进入TXEIE中断,主循环都无法执行
STM32的低功耗模式
四轴飞行器
不清楚为什么正点原子的例程,想添加SCB添加到watch1却是无效的(在core_cm3.h定义的寄存器都不可以),但是可以添加GPIOA并且有效(stm32f10x.h定义的寄存器都可以)
不知道为什么用正点原子的开源例程硬件仿真时。想观察寄存器的值,所以添加到watch1观察,不清楚为啥SCB,NVTC等都添加了但是无效,但是GPIOA却又可以。
STM32的上电启动过程
可以参照这个:https://blog.csdn.net/Chasing_Chasing/article/details/116458804
需要定时器资源
看看有没可能串口引脚切换,分时复用串口。
如果是简单的数据传输,可以考虑。如果通讯量大的情况下,建议还是用串口模块,这样会比较稳定。ST最多可以支持到6路串口,可以考虑换个型号。
输入的麻烦些,试试外部中断+定时器
学**。